ApTap is on a mission to connect banks and brands, to help people save money. We want to reinvent how people interact with their finances by making money management simpler, smarter, and more personal.

ApTap enables data-driven, end-to-end, fully embedded user experiences within banking apps – think bill switching, rewards, discounts, competitions, and much more. We’ve already saved British consumers hundreds of thousands of pounds, working with clients like Barclays, BNP Paribas, Lloyds, TSB Bank, and more.

From product design to marketing to data science, we’re integrating cutting-edge AI tools and machine learning models across our stack to accelerate growth and deliver real value to users.

We’re a scale-up with big ambitions. That means joining us is an opportunity to make a tangible impact from day one, with plenty of headroom for growth. We value entrepreneurial thinkers who aren’t afraid to challenge the status quo, move fast, and experiment.

Role: Data Engineer – ML & AI Applications

Location: London (Hybrid)
Salary: £40,000-£60,000 + benefits/equity (depending on experience)

About the Role

We’re looking for a Data Engineer to join our growing data team and support our Head of Data. You’ll work on building and deploying machine learning models, implementing AI capabilities across our product stack, and supporting product and partnerships teams with optimisation projects.

This is an opportunity to work across greenfield AI/ML projects, applying the latest tools to real-world fintech and consumer banking challenges. You’ll run your own projects while contributing to the broader data and product strategy.

This is not a role for someone looking to learn the ropes from scratch, instead this is a role for people who are ready to build models and execute.

What You’ll Do

  • Design, build, and maintain scalable data pipelines and infrastructure
  • Develop and deploy machine learning models into production
  • Collaborate with data science, product, partnerships, and client teams on optimisation projects
  • Research, explore, and integrate new AI/ML frameworks into the product
  • Ensure data quality, integrity, and performance at scale
  • Contribute to a culture of experimentation and innovation

What We’re Looking For

  • 2+ years’ experience or higher-degree in data engineering, ML engineering, or related fields
  • Strong Python and SQL skills; familiarity with cloud platforms (AWS, GCP, or Azure)
  • Experience deploying ML models and working with modern data stacks
  • Appetite for applying AI tools across different product areas
  • Bonus: experience in FinTech, InsurTech, MarTech, or adjacent industries
